I want to say have it like DOOM glory kills where the enemy stops shooting at you, but this would apply to AI, as assassinating a warden or Knight boss getting interupted gets very annoying.
Assassinations have some of the longest kill times in the game, and are a inefficient means of dispatching enemies.

Those kinds of people are also the ones that would chase an assassination opportunity across whole maps. They see someone with their back turned halfway across a WZ map, and off they go, chasing someone they could have easily taken out any other way. In fact, just the other day, someone with an overshield on tried to get a free assassination on an AFK teammate of mine in BTB, and he must have forgotten that he had a radar, because he didn’t see my blip nearby. I beat him down just before he got the chance to take out the guy he wanted to.
I don’t assassinate anyone unless I’m sure I can pull it off. I use it on people who are isolated, distracted, and unaware of my presence. Only when I’m sure no one else is nearby, and when no one has a line of sight on me or my victim. Otherwise, I’m gonna be stopped midway, either by my greedy twelve-year-old teammates, or by the hostiles nearby.
You don’t need to toggle them off. Just choose your victims very carefully.
